Black First Land First leader steps up harassment of journalists, despite court action

A defiant Andile Mngxitama has taken aim at 702 presenter Eusebius Mckaiser, despite legal action being taken against him and his association.

Gupta loyalist and leader of the Black First Land First movement (BLF) Andile Mngxitama has taken aim at 702 radio presenter and award-winning journalist and author Eusebius Mckaiser; as part of his campaign against, well… anyone who’d dare expose him or his paymasters for the crooks they are.

Andile has made a habit of putting his foot in it at every opportunity and has been a constant in the news thanks to his organisation’s obsession with moral bankruptcy and the limelight that goes with it.

He and his cabal even went as far as physically intimidating and harassing senior journalists, which prompted legal action by the South African National Editor’s Forum (Sanef) which sought an urgent interdict against his organisation’s foolishness — dangerous, but still foolish at the end of the day –.

Despite the looming legal implications of his actions, Andile refused to relent and, well… took to Twitter — that age-old platform for dumbassery — to sling a slur Mckaiser’s way; accusing the journalist of suffering from Lekgowa Laka, according to the Tweet a mental illness suffered by black people.

You might think this is the dumbest thing Andile has done so far, but then you’d be forgetting that he also blamed the severe storms that hit the Cape a while back on White Monopoly Capital.
